.wp-block-youtube-banner-frame-youtube-banner .ybf-block-wrapper{margin:0 auto;max-width:100%}.wp-block-youtube-banner-frame-youtube-banner .ybf-frame-container{background-color:#fff;border:2px solid #ccc;border-radius:8px;box-sizing:border-box;display:block;overflow:hidden}.wp-block-youtube-banner-frame-youtube-banner .ybf-frame-content{box-sizing:border-box;padding:8px}.wp-block-youtube-banner-frame-youtube-banner .ybf-video-container{background:#000;border-radius:calc(var(--frame-border-radius, 8px) - 8px);margin-bottom:0;overflow:hidden;position:relative}.wp-block-youtube-banner-frame-youtube-banner .ybf-video-wrapper{height:0;padding-bottom:56.25%;position:relative;width:100%}.wp-block-youtube-banner-frame-youtube-banner .ybf-video-wrapper iframe{border:0;height:100%;left:0;position:absolute;top:0;width:100%}.wp-block-youtube-banner-frame-youtube-banner .ybf-overlay{cursor:pointer;max-height:150px;max-width:200px;opacity:0;position:absolute;transition:opacity .5s ease-in-out;z-index:10}.wp-block-youtube-banner-frame-youtube-banner .ybf-overlay.ybf-overlay-visible{opacity:1}.wp-block-youtube-banner-frame-youtube-banner .ybf-overlay.ybf-overlay-hidden{opacity:0;pointer-events:none}.wp-block-youtube-banner-frame-youtube-banner .ybf-overlay.ybf-overlay-top-left{left:15px;top:15px}.wp-block-youtube-banner-frame-youtube-banner .ybf-overlay.ybf-overlay-top-center{left:50%;top:15px;transform:translateX(-50%)}.wp-block-youtube-banner-frame-youtube-banner .ybf-overlay.ybf-overlay-top-right{right:15px;top:15px}.wp-block-youtube-banner-frame-youtube-banner .ybf-overlay.ybf-overlay-center{left:50%;top:50%;transform:translate(-50%,-50%)}.wp-block-youtube-banner-frame-youtube-banner .ybf-overlay.ybf-overlay-bottom-left{bottom:15px;left:15px}.wp-block-youtube-banner-frame-youtube-banner .ybf-overlay.ybf-overlay-bottom-center{bottom:15px;left:50%;transform:translateX(-50%)}.wp-block-youtube-banner-frame-youtube-banner .ybf-overlay.ybf-overlay-bottom-right{bottom:15px;right:15px}.wp-block-youtube-banner-frame-youtube-banner .ybf-overlay .ybf-overlay-image,.wp-block-youtube-banner-frame-youtube-banner .ybf-overlay .ybf-overlay-link{display:block;position:relative}.wp-block-youtube-banner-frame-youtube-banner .ybf-overlay img{border-radius:6px;box-shadow:0 4px 12px rgba(0,0,0,.4);height:auto;transition:transform .2s ease;width:100%}.wp-block-youtube-banner-frame-youtube-banner .ybf-overlay img:hover{transform:scale(1.05)}.wp-block-youtube-banner-frame-youtube-banner .ybf-overlay .ybf-overlay-close{align-items:center;background:#f44;border:none;border-radius:50%;box-shadow:0 2px 6px rgba(0,0,0,.3);color:#fff;cursor:pointer;display:flex;font-size:16px;height:28px;justify-content:center;line-height:1;position:absolute;right:-10px;top:-10px;transition:all .2s ease;width:28px;z-index:11}.wp-block-youtube-banner-frame-youtube-banner .ybf-overlay .ybf-overlay-close:hover{background:#c00;transform:scale(1.1)}.wp-block-youtube-banner-frame-youtube-banner .ybf-overlay .ybf-overlay-close:focus{outline:2px solid #fff;outline-offset:2px}.wp-block-youtube-banner-frame-youtube-banner .ybf-bottom-banner{margin-top:8px;padding:0;text-align:center}.wp-block-youtube-banner-frame-youtube-banner .ybf-bottom-banner .ybf-banner-link{display:inline-block;text-decoration:none;transition:transform .2s ease}.wp-block-youtube-banner-frame-youtube-banner .ybf-bottom-banner .ybf-banner-link:hover{transform:translateY(-2px)}.wp-block-youtube-banner-frame-youtube-banner .ybf-bottom-banner .ybf-banner-image{border-radius:6px;box-shadow:0 2px 8px rgba(0,0,0,.1);height:auto;max-width:100%;transition:box-shadow .2s ease}.ybf-banner-link:hover .wp-block-youtube-banner-frame-youtube-banner .ybf-bottom-banner .ybf-banner-image{box-shadow:0 4px 16px rgba(0,0,0,.2)}.wp-block-youtube-banner-frame-youtube-banner .ybf-bottom-banner .ybf-banner-text{background:#f8f9fa;border:1px solid #dee2e6;border-radius:6px;color:#495057;display:inline-block;font-weight:500;padding:12px 24px;transition:all .2s ease}.ybf-banner-link:hover .wp-block-youtube-banner-frame-youtube-banner .ybf-bottom-banner .ybf-banner-text{background:#e9ecef;border-color:#adb5bd;color:#212529}@media(max-width:768px){.wp-block-youtube-banner-frame-youtube-banner .ybf-overlay{max-height:105px;max-width:140px}.wp-block-youtube-banner-frame-youtube-banner .ybf-overlay.ybf-overlay-top-center,.wp-block-youtube-banner-frame-youtube-banner .ybf-overlay.ybf-overlay-top-left,.wp-block-youtube-banner-frame-youtube-banner .ybf-overlay.ybf-overlay-top-right{top:10px}.wp-block-youtube-banner-frame-youtube-banner .ybf-overlay.ybf-overlay-bottom-center,.wp-block-youtube-banner-frame-youtube-banner .ybf-overlay.ybf-overlay-bottom-left,.wp-block-youtube-banner-frame-youtube-banner .ybf-overlay.ybf-overlay-bottom-right{bottom:10px}.wp-block-youtube-banner-frame-youtube-banner .ybf-overlay.ybf-overlay-bottom-left,.wp-block-youtube-banner-frame-youtube-banner .ybf-overlay.ybf-overlay-top-left{left:10px}.wp-block-youtube-banner-frame-youtube-banner .ybf-overlay.ybf-overlay-bottom-right,.wp-block-youtube-banner-frame-youtube-banner .ybf-overlay.ybf-overlay-top-right{right:10px}.wp-block-youtube-banner-frame-youtube-banner .ybf-overlay .ybf-overlay-close{font-size:14px;height:24px;right:-8px;top:-8px;width:24px}.wp-block-youtube-banner-frame-youtube-banner .ybf-bottom-banner{margin-top:10px}.wp-block-youtube-banner-frame-youtube-banner .ybf-bottom-banner .ybf-banner-text{font-size:14px;padding:10px 16px}}@media(max-width:480px){.wp-block-youtube-banner-frame-youtube-banner .ybf-overlay{max-height:75px;max-width:100px}}@media(prefers-reduced-motion:reduce){.wp-block-youtube-banner-frame-youtube-banner .ybf-bottom-banner .ybf-banner-image,.wp-block-youtube-banner-frame-youtube-banner .ybf-bottom-banner .ybf-banner-link,.wp-block-youtube-banner-frame-youtube-banner .ybf-bottom-banner .ybf-banner-text,.wp-block-youtube-banner-frame-youtube-banner .ybf-overlay,.wp-block-youtube-banner-frame-youtube-banner .ybf-overlay .ybf-overlay-close,.wp-block-youtube-banner-frame-youtube-banner .ybf-overlay img{transition:none}}@media(prefers-contrast:high){.wp-block-youtube-banner-frame-youtube-banner .ybf-overlay .ybf-overlay-close{border:2px solid #fff}.wp-block-youtube-banner-frame-youtube-banner .ybf-bottom-banner .ybf-banner-text{border-width:2px}}
